Charge sheet filed against crew members of US ship

TUTICORIN: The Q branch police on Monday filed a charge sheet at judicial magistrate court-1 here against 35 crew members of the MV Seaman Guard Ohio, the US-based ship detained for trespassing into Indian territorial water carrying arms and ammunition.

The 2,158-page charge sheet has named 45 persons as accused, including the owners of the Advanfort – the US-based maritime security agency, 35 crew members and five locals who helped in supplying diesel to the ship. Three more locals named in the charge sheet are absconding. The judicial magistrate court at Tuticorin granted conditional bail on December 26 to the crew members of the ship on the ground that the charge sheet was not filed within 60 days of the arrest.
